Transaction 7bbc30329520f64160e4243a09bb69a846fdff75844234a99b7f8fd087a811ea

1 Input
2 Outputs
  • 7bbc30329520f64160e4243a09bb69a846fdff75844234a99b7f8fd087a811ea:0
  • value  2121361
    address  1MceFci9tarJfCAgXcYtLxMbQyFotm3eCu
  • 7bbc30329520f64160e4243a09bb69a846fdff75844234a99b7f8fd087a811ea:1
  • value  54572
    address  3Fdyd8HUXd8FHS86JpvF5zs9cV9pBcLz2g